Commenting on a theft from the Natural History Museum, AD’s spokesman Noel Agius said: “A speck of moon rock costing Lm2 million has been stolen from the Natural History Museum. When one considers that some of our monuments and museums are left with no protection whatsoever, it is very difficult to justify any cut-back in the budget for Heritage Malta.
“Such cut-backs, apart from having the effect of making our tourist product less attractive, actually end up costing the state money in terms of vandalism and stolen objects”, he concluded.
